I saw Rory play at a Saturdaynight in Rotterdam in 1974 in De Doelen. Due to the oilcrisis, we had mandatory car free Sundays. They played until the first train left on that sundaymorning. No need to say the train home (a 2 hours travel) was packed with people singing Rory's songs, sharing drinks and having a great time. Experience of a lifetime.....
